Role-Based Access Control in Japan Trends and Forecast
The future of the role-based access control market in Japan looks promising with opportunities in the BFSI, IT & telecom, government & defense, retail & consumer good, education, healthcare, and energy & utility markets. The global role-based access control market is expected to reach an estimated $15.7 billion by 2031 with a CAGR of 10.5% from 2025 to 2031. The role-based access control market in Japan is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the growing trend of using role-based access control (RBAC) systems created specifically for DevOps environments, increasing adoption of "bring your own device" (BYOD) policies in offices, as well as, rise in spending on cutting-edge technologies including IoT, cloud-based services, AI, and ML.
• Lucintel forecasts that, within the component category, the solution is expected to witness higher growth over the forecast period.
• Within the end use category, BFSI will remain the largest segment due to increasing focus on strengthening cybersecurity protocols in the BFSI industry.

Role-Based Access Control Market in Japan Driver and Challenges
Economic, technological, and regulatory factors intertwine to shape the Japanese market for role-based access control. Japanese companies are purchasing RBAC technologies to mitigate emerging cybersecurity threats, comply with data privacy laws, and bolster their digital defenses. However, these organizations need to overcome the challenges of integrating new technologies into existing legacy infrastructure and managing multifaceted relationships. Below are five key drivers and three challenges impacting the RBAC market in Japan.
The factors responsible for driving the role-based access control market in Japan include:
• Escalating Cyber-attacks: With the increased occurrence of cyberattacks globally, Japan is paying more attention to cyber protection. Sensitive data needing protection is secured with RBAC solutions that set restrictive access measures to mitigate breaches and enhance security.
• Compliance Headaches: In particular, the Act on the Protection of Personal Information (APPI) places Japanese businesses under rigid control, enabling them to impose harsh penalties for non-compliance. With these systems, organizations can control personal data access and avoid sanctions for non-compliance.
• Cloud Consumption: Japan’s sustained increase in the adoption of cloud technology has necessitated the consumption of RBAC systems, which mark cloud technology. Organizations can efficiently control access for users within different networks and digital systems because of these systems.
Challenges in the role-based access control market in Japan are:
• Integration with Legacy Systems: Many companies in Japan still operate using outdated IT systems. This can be challenging because pre-existing systems were not designed to work with modern RBAC approaches, which limits control over access and reduces practicality. Modern RBAC implementation techniques are often delayed in larger institutions, where access control tends to be complex, ill-defined, and poorly managed.
• Complex Role Management: As companies expand, assigning and managing user roles becomes more challenging. This is especially crucial in large companies that need to ensure all assigned roles are accurate and properly documented to close security loopholes and comply with legislation.
• Implementation Costs: The costs incurred during the setup and maintenance of RBAC systems can be a barrier for small and medium-sized enterprises (SMEs). Furthermore, integrating an organization’s existing IT infrastructure can pose prohibitive costs when combined with the ongoing maintenance required for RBAC systems.
The use of RBAC in Japan is rapidly expanding due to the growing digital threats to security and the increasing need to comply with regulations. However, challenges such as integration with legacy systems, complex role management, and high implementation costs need to be addressed. While businesses are embracing RBAC systems, overcoming these challenges will be crucial for managing complex digital security environments and ensuring compliance with multifaceted regulations.
